@mbta.com Projects Get A $850 Million Boost From Fair Share Funds
#mapoli
mass.streetsblog.org/2025/10/17/m...
#mapoli
mass.streetsblog.org/2025/10/17/m...
MBTA Projects Get A $850 Million Boost From Fair Share Funds - Streetsblog Massachusetts
The new funding will pay for backlogged "state of good repair" projects, accessibility improvements, and new maintenance facilities for electric buses and trains.

Air quality monitoring agency concludes that clean transport initiatives in Paris – including 1,500 km of new bikeways, conversion of on-street car parking to gardens, and lower speed limits on the Périphérique highway – saved France €61 billion over 10 years in reduced health care costs.
